W 120 R cold milling Wirtgen is used to remove asphalt and concrete surfaces quickly and efficiently. In doing so, they create a level foundation with the specified width and depth that is required for paving new surface layers of uniform thickness. This is important, because the condition of the milled surface has a major impact on the quality of the new surface layers, their performance characteristics, and on the cost-effective completion of further construction work. When pavements re milled in layers, the milled material can be separated and selectively recovered according to mix type.
In cold milling, a distinction is made between maintenance (minor construction measures to preserve the structural integrity of the surface), repair (major construction measures to preserve the structural integrity of the surface and improve its properties), and rehabilitation (complete restoration).

Today’s technologically advanced cold milling machines can load a 30-ton truck with asphalt granulate within a few minutes. The road to this point was a long one, however WIRTGEN has always been instrumental in driving progress in this field.
WIRTGEN built the first of a total of 100 hot milling machines for its own service fleet in 1971. The idea to use the round shank bits used in mining with carbide tips made the technological transition from hot milling to cold milling possible in 1979.
From the first building block the development of cold milling technology for road construction to the present day, WIRTGEN has reached numerous innovative milestones along the road to this technology’s success. Today, the name WIRTGEN is synonymous with high-performance cold milling technology throughout the world.
- 1971: The first prototype of a hot milling machine successfully removes damaged asphalt surfaces.
- 1979: The first cold milling machine, the 3800 C, is a rear loader with hydraulic milling drum drive.
- 1980: The 500 C, the first half-meter cold milling machine, mills to a depth of 100 mm.
- 1984: The first front loader, the 2000 VC, permanently changes job site logistics.
- 1988: The DC series with working depths up to 300 mm extends the range of applications considerably.
- 1992: The first bolted toolholder system increases cold milling machines’ operational availability
- 2001: The FCS quick-change system for milling drums increases the flexibility of the machines
- 2009: The VCS extraction system reduces dust emissions during operation.
- 2010: The new generation of large milling machines – the W 200 to W 250 sets new standards in milling performance.
- 2015: Wirtgen W 50 Ri and W 100 CFi embody a new, highly effective method of operating small milling machines.
- 2019: The new F series of large milling machines, with MILL ASSIST and the Performance racker, set new standards of costeffectiveness.

In order to efficiently remove pavement with precision, it is essential that the milling drum, pick holder, and round shaft pick work together perfectly. WIRTGEN is the market leader in cutting technology and offers customers high-performance cutting systems whose components are designed to be fully compatible. In addition, WIRTGEN continuously makes advancements to these cutting technology components, incorporating its practical experience and feedback from customers into the process.
The heavy-duty picks offer maximum wear resistance. This increases milling performance and extends the intervals between tool changes.
The rugged HT22 toolholder system minimizes downtimes and increases the service life of the entire milling drum.
The HT22 PLUS toolholder upper part features innovative centering marks (Fig. 3) on the tool contact surface. In combination with the X² generation of round shaft picks, this reduces toolholder wear by up to 25% and also optimizes the rotation behavior of the picks. The upper part offers considerable benefits such as higher milled surface quality and longer intervals between changes.

When milling, it’s important to remove the layers of asphalt at the specified depth. WIRTGEN’s intuitive LEVEL PRO/ LEVEL PRO PLUS /LEVEL PRO ACTIVE leveling technology can be relied on to precisely maintain the specified milling depth. The high-tech leveling system developed in-house at WIRTGEN with software specially programmed for cold milling machines is fully integrated into the control system of the entire machine. LEVEL PRO/LEVEL PRO PLUS / LEVEL PRO ACTIVE constantly compares the current milling depth with the preset target value.
If the system detects deviations, they are dynamically and proportionally corrected. The actual milling depth is determined via optical or mechanical sensors that continuously scan a reference surface.
The WIRTGEN leveling system can not only be operated with a wide variety of sensors, but can also be extended as required for example with the multiplex system, laser leveling, or thanks to a preinstalled interface, with 3D leveling.

State-of-the-art cold milling machines are efficient construction machines whose key success factor is their high milling performance. Intelligent, computer-assisted automatic functions assist the operator so that they need to intervene in the milling process as little as possible. With WIRTGEN high-performance cold milling machines, for example, the operator is supported by the innovative proprietary MILL ASSIST machine control system.
In automatic mode, MILL ASSIST always selects the operating strategy with the best balance between performance and costs. In doing so, the process optimization automatically adjusts the speed of the diesel engine and milling drum, the travel drive, the water system, and the machine’s advance speed. This significantly reduces the operator’s workload while improving machine performance and considerably reducing diesel consumption, CO2 emissions, and noise.

Small Milling Machines
WIRTGEN’s small milling machines stand out particularly for their outstanding versatility and flexibility. Thanks to their maneuverability, they are the ideal solution for milling jobs where space is at a premium. Their compact dimensions also make it easier to transport them.
The machines’ minimal milling radius is ideal for milling around road installations and obstacles as well as around tight curves. In addition, special milling drums and ancillary equipment make it easy to mill rumble strips, slots, and tie-ins.
W 120 R small milling machines are also the best choice for the rehabilitation of industrial spaces and production hall floors due to their small size. The same applies to patching specific sections of road or adding and removing road surface markings.
Compact Milling Machines
Compact milling machines from WIRTGEN combine the benefits of small and large milling machines and therefore offer tremendous flexibility. The machines, which are operated as front loaders, are particularly maneuverable on the one hand, but also offer a high level of performance on the other.
As a result, the compact class is suitable for milling jobs in tight spaces, for example, but also for removing entire road surfaces. Original WIRTGEN fine milling drums can be used to produce specific surface structures.
Compact milling machines can also be used for spot road repairs and the removal of road pavements in layers, as well as for smoothing out irregularities in the surface layer.
Large Milling Machines
WIRTGEN’s most powerful class of milling machines is particularly suitable for the rehabilitation of large areas. Their impressive milling performance means that large milling machines can complete construction projects much faster, thereby minimizing traffic disruptions.
Front loading ensures that the milled material is optimally loaded, and keeps the milling process flowing by continuously filling the trucks on the fly. In addition, this allows the trucks to move in and out smoothly in the direction of traffic.
Large milling machines countless applications include he removal of road pavements in layers or the complete removal of road surfaces at milling depths of up to 35 cm.
Special milling drums can also be used to produce specific surface structures (fine milling) and improve grip. Large milling machines are also the first choice for smoothing out irregularities in the surface layer.
